Cloud-to-ground lightning is a product of excess negative ions

in the base of the cloud seeking to neutralize with the positive
charge found on the ground
True or false

1 Answer

3 votes

Answer:

True

Step-by-step explanation:

The excess of negative ions in the base of a cloud induce a positive charge on the surface of the ground because the negative ions (electrons) on the surface are repelled. This process involves the discharge of electrical energy (static discharge) in the form of lightning, which creates a pathway for the flow of electrons between the cloud and the ground, neutralizing the charge imbalance.
